SQL Server - Error al intentar borrar una tabla, because it is

 
Vista:

Error al intentar borrar una tabla, because it is

Publicado por Javier (1 intervención) el 13/03/2009 11:27:57
Hola a todos, tengo el siguiente problemas. Tengo creadas una serie de tablas con sus correspondiente primary keys y foreign keys, pero si quiero borrar una tabla y esta contiene foreign keys me da el siguiente error:

Could not drop object 'dbo.tbuser' because it is referenced by a FOREIGN KEY constraint.

Soy nuevo con SQL Server 2005 y no se muy bien como solucionarlo.


Un saludo y g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de roger

RE:Error al intentar borrar una tabla, because it

Publicado por roger (173 intervenciones) el 13/03/2009 13:52:13
no puedes borrar estas tablas, si antes no has borrado las tablas que dependen de ella. Es decir no puedes borrar la tabla alumnos (por ejemplo), si tienes todavia las materias asociadas a ese alumno en otra tabla, para eso es la integridad referencial, y eso garantiza la consistencia de tus datos.
Busca la tabla dale click derecho , modificar, y hay un icono en donde al dar click se ven las relaciones que tiene, ahi miras que tablas dependen de la que quieres borrar, y las borras primero
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ar